Elements 11 contact sheet problem

how can I prevent a vertical slice being taken from photos when printing a contact sheet?

In the dialog #4, "Type of Print>Contact Sheet", untick "crop to fit."

  • Printing file & caption on contact sheet- Problem seeing full string

    I am attempting to print a two column, 4 row contact sheet with file name & caption below the image. I can tweak the cell spacing vertical size slider which reduces the size of the image and can see all the file name & caption, which may be 2-3 lines.  I have selected file & caption along with a space after the string in the photo info section on the right and clicked done, then control clicked and saved template settings. I can print that sheet with all info. When I switch to another group of images using that saved template, all I can see is a single line of text. If I slightly tweak the vertical size slider, the image becomes a bit smaller and I can see the full text string, but in order to see full file & caption info, I have to tweak the slider for each sheet. If I go back to the previous group of images, the image is larger, I see a single line of text and I have to re-tweak the vertical size slider. I have a large number of sheets to print with file & caption info. How do I configure settings so I can save the full text string and don't have to tweak each sheet.

    Ben3C,
    I have found the same problem.  What I have done is saved a template with the number of colums and rows desired.  I went into the 'Photo Info'under the Page area and using custom set up what I want to be printed below each image.  As I said, this is saved as a template.  Then when I select a group of images to print I select the previously displayed template.  This is when the caption will revert to only one line.  Then just select a different template (I usually select the filename.  Then reselect your custome template that you built.  All the lines of the caption will then show and print.  I have printed contact sheets with up to 10 rows of information and Lightroom will automatically resize the image so both the image and caption will fit within the cell area.

  • Contact sheet in elements 12

    I was using elements 12 to make a contact sheet, it worked at first but now I get an error "Could not complete the Contact Sheet II command because of a program error."I have followed instructions for preferences does anyone have any other ideas?

    Are you using the mac version or the windows version? It's very different between the two. On a mac you must be in the editor in expert mode to create a contact sheet, which you do by going to File>Contact Sheet II. If it's grayed out, you probably need to click the word Expert at the top of the editor window.
    99jon has been giving you the windows directions. The red and green buttons you mention usually only appear in the editor and you need to be in the organizer in windows.

  • Cannot open Contact Sheet II on my Elements 12, gives me error message. Can anyone help with this?

    In Elements 12, I cannot open Contact Sheet II. I keep getting an error message.  Can anyone help with this?

    That's a different file.
    Try this:
    1. Click on your desktop
    2. Then in the Go menu click on Go To Folder
    3. Paste the following line in the Go To Folder dialog and press Go
    ~/Library/Preferences/Adobe/Plugins/Adobe Contact Sheet II PSE12/Elements
    4. That should open a finder window something like below.
       Drag the Adobe Contact Sheet PSE12 Prefs to the Trash on the dock
    5. Start the pse 12 editor and see the contact sheet II works.
